This is completely contradictory to the theme of this thread, but if you can achieve a nice 'brushed metal' effect by rubbing with a simple washing up sponge.. The rough, dark green side obviously. I used to do it to iPods, looks nice and covers up existing scratches.
Depending on how deep it is you should have no problem, even when using power tools and buffing rouge you are taking off phenomenally small amounts of metal.
My only suggestion would be to start with the second grade of sandpaper and go slowly.
